Heritage

From a space program to a world first in color

The engineering behind TRUE began in 1992, with video engineers from a former space program. That lineage led to the first dvLED with its own control system in 1997, and in 2024 to the world’s first Pantone validated dvLED display solution. The same team is now pursuing the world’s first DICOM certified dvLED.

1992

Space program roots

Founded by video engineers who built imaging systems for a former space program, then turned that precision to LED.

2024

World’s first Pantone validated dvLED

The first dvLED display solution in the world to carry Pantone validation, proven together with Porsche Design.

Now

Pursuing DICOM certification

Developing the world’s first DICOM certified dvLED, the color standard trusted in medical imaging.

Technology

The whole signal path, owned by one team

From the LED surface, whether COB, MIP, SMD or IMD, through to the ERMAC control system, every link is TRUE’s own engineering. At its heart sits the Color Space Engine, which holds a Pantone validated reproduction across brightness levels and across production batches, so the signal you send stays untouched all the way to the pixel.

FAQ

dvLED, answered

What makes TRUE Performance different from other dvLED suppliers?

TRUE Performance develops and manufactures both the LED panels and the control and processing system in house, in Europe. Almost every supplier makes only one half, either the panels or the controller. Owning both, as one integrated system, is what lets us reach reference grade color and detail accuracy.

Does TRUE really make both the LED panels and the control system?

Yes. Both the panels and the ERMAC control system are TRUE’s own research and production, refined over more than thirty years. It is one calibrated signal path, not parts bought in from separate vendors.

Why does controlling both the panel and the processing improve image quality?

Color and detail accuracy depend on the panel and the processing working as one calibrated system. When one company designs both, calibration runs the whole way through. That is why fields where color has to be exact, such as automotive design, rely on TRUE.

Where is TRUE Performance based, and where is the product made?

TRUE Performance develops and manufactures its dvLED panels and control systems in Europe. It is the only company doing dvLED research and production on the continent.
